Area Girls Prep Basketball Report for Wednesday, Nov. 14

Two-time defending Division I state champion John Curtis Christian opened its 2018-19 season with a convincing 59-29 victory at Mandeville Tuesday evening.

John Curtis jumped out to an 18-8 lead after one quarter and increased its lead to 37-16. The lead grew to 54-20 after three quarters and the Patriots costed to victory. Kristen Baham led the Skippers with nine points.

The Lady Patriots will host Madison Prep Friday at 6 p.m. in its first home game while Mandeville visits Independence Friday at 5 p.m.
